The Uddhav Thackeray faction of the Shiv Sena on Monday moved the Supreme Court challenging Maharashtra Legislative Assembly Speaker Rahul Narwekar`s order declaring the Shiv Sena bloc led by Maharashtra Chief Minister Eknath Shinde as the "real political party" after its split in June 2022, reported the PTI.
The speaker had also also rejected the Uddhav Thackeray faction`s plea to disqualify 16 MLAs of the ruling camp, including CM Shinde.
